New Jersey Statutes, Title: 26, HEALTH AND VITAL STATISTICS

    Chapter 2k:

      Section: 26:2k-28: Advertising restrictions

           a. No person may advertise or disseminate information to the public that the person provides intermediate life support services, unless the person is authorized to do so pursuant to this act.

b. No person may impersonate or refer to himself as an EMT-intermediate unless he is certified pursuant to section 6 of this act.

L. 1985, c. 351, s. 9.
